IN LOVING MEMORY OF
Jeanetta A.
(Steinback) Brannaka
September 24, 1932 – March 24, 2023
Jeanetta "Jimmie" Brannaka, 90, of Trout Run, PA (Lewis Twp.) passed away peacefully, Friday evening, March 24, 2023, at her home while surrounded by loving family. Born on September 24, 1932, in her home in Calvert, Lycoming County. She was the only daughter of eight children born to the late George and Violet (Smith) Steinback.
Jimmie, as she was known, was a 1950 graduate of Montoursville High School. On May 2, 1954, she married Charles Brannaka in Calvert. Together they raised six children and established their family's business, Brannaka's Garage and Excavating until retiring following 43 years as Charlie's office manager. Jeanetta also worked for Sylvania prior to marriage and later was a long-time secretary for Lewis Twp. as well as secretary/treasurer for Pennsdale Cemetery Association. She loved the outdoors, gardening, tending to her flowers and mowing yard on her Kubota mowing tractor. Jeanetta maintained multiple bird feeding stations on her porch, serving a wide variety of birds. She was an avid reader and truly enjoyed listening to audiobooks. Very special times were spent with her many beloved grandchildren and great grandchildren.
Surviving are her children; Wesley (Cindy) Brannaka of Roaring Branch, Sue Ann Huston of Trout Run, Judy (Jim) Cronin of Greer, SC, Mary Lou (Dion) Coleman, Dave (Marilyn) Seeling all of Trout Run, 14 grandchildren, 28 great grandchildren (with another pending), two siblings; Guy Steinback of Montgomery, Darrel (Dot) Steinback of Williamsport. Besides her husband of 61 years, Charlie, she was predeceased by a daughter, Billie Jo Cuozzo and five brothers.
